Almora innovator successfully tests electric flying car, says it aims to provide personal sky mobility

Ravi Tamta said the prototype passed a supervised trial and could help make personal sky mobility more accessible, he told ANI.

Summary by India TV News
An Almora-based innovator, Ravi Tamta, has developed and successfully tested a prototype of an electric flying vehicle in a bid to provide personal sky mobility to the people. Tamta developed the vehicle, called Hapida Skynex, for a year, and it underwent a trial under administrative supervision with adequate safety arrangements. He stated that the test was successful.
